What is a Glass and Wrought Iron Kitchen Table?
A glass and wrought iron kitchen table is a table that has a glass top and a wrought iron base. The glass top provides an elegant and modern look, while the wrought iron base adds a touch of rustic charm.

Pros and Cons of Glass and Wrought Iron Kitchen Table
Pros:
– Elegant and modern look
– Durable and easy to clean
– Complements various styles
– Resistant to scratches and stains
Cons:
– Can be heavy and difficult to move
– Glass top may crack or shatter if dropped or hit hard
– May require more maintenance than wooden tables

Question & Answer and FAQs
Q: Can a glass and wrought iron kitchen table handle hot pots and pans?
A: It is not recommended to place hot pots and pans directly on the glass top as it may cause cracking or damage. It is best to use a trivet or hot pad to protect the table’s surface.
Q: How do I clean a glass and wrought iron kitchen table?
A: Use a mild glass cleaner and a soft cloth to clean the glass top. For the wrought iron base, use a damp cloth to wipe it down and dry it immediately to prevent rusting.
Q: Can I use the glass and wrought iron kitchen table outdoors?
A: No, it is not recommended to use a glass and wrought iron kitchen table outdoors as the glass top may shatter due to extreme temperatures or weather conditions.
